Standard Necklace Lengths

First, it’s useful to get familiar with the standard necklace lengths and their corresponding names. These are:

  • Collar (12-14 inches): Sits right against the throat, often in multiple strands. This type of necklace goes great with boat necks, off-the-shoulder, or V-neck tops.
  • Choker (14-16 inches): Sits at the base of the neck. A classic choker can be paired with virtually any outfit.
  • Princess (18-20 inches): Falls just below the throat at the collarbone. This length is ideal for pendants and is extremely versatile.
  • Matinee (22-24 inches): Lies a few inches below the collarbone. This length is great for casual or business attire.
  • Opera (28-36 inches): Hangs below the bust or can be doubled over to act as a choker. It’s great for high necklines and evening wear.

For the right choice of length, consider the following 

Body Type and Neck Size

One of the most important factors when choosing a necklace length is the wearer’s body type and neck size. For example, chokers typically look best on people with long, slender necks. If the neck is on the shorter or wider side, a princess or matinee length necklace might be more flattering.

Feminine Style

Chokers enhance a feminine sensual look. They flatter the neckline and go well with both daytime and evening outfits. They can be worn for a variety of settings. Getting ready for a romantic dinner? Get dolled up and put on a pearl choker necklace. Going for a night out with the girls? Spice up your outfit with a chain choker. Remember that chokers best suit clothing that allow your collarbones to show like V-necks or scoop necklines.

Layering necklaces reveal a playful feminine style. They are fun and versatile allowing you to choose lengths that enhance the beauty around your neck and collarbones. When grouping necklaces together, you can play with different metals, stones, and lengths to find the right combination for your outfit or occasion. Try not to layer too many statement pieces together. Instead, opt for one or two eye-catchers, then use delicate chains and minimalist pieces as accents.

Business or Formal Style

A formal look is both minimal and elegant. Most shirts and tops that match a suit allow the central part of your collarbones to show. So, chain and pearl necklaces should be slightly below or above your collarbones. Classic white pearls take all outfits to the next level. Minimal diamond and stud chains bring a mix of elegance and charm to any suit. Chains and paperclip chains are also incredibly attractive and sophisticated at that length.
